Traditional major events and conferences, which see all presenters and delegates fly to one site, leave a significant carbon footprint. In fact, research has found the annual carbon footprint for the global event industry is of the same order of magnitude as the yearly greenhouse gas emissions of the entire United States and responsible for more than 10% of global CO2 emissions (Emissions Database for Global Atmospheric Research).

However, bringing your people together to align them with strategy, build culture and connection, launch new products, reward, recognise and celebrate is a business imperative. So how to harmonise this need in a more sustainable way?

Here, I sat down with my co-Director of Synergy Effect, Michael Fleck, to hear his top tips for creating more sustainable events.

1.?????Clearly define sustainability and create objectives flowing from this

Sustainability is often perceived as only environmental factors.?However, using the United Nation’s sustainability definition, the concept is comprised of three pillars: social inclusion,?governance, and the environment.?

“We should be looking for ways to make business operations and strategies - including events - more inclusive, driven by social and cultural awareness, while at the same time lessening the environmental impact and helping our people to better connect with nature,” said Michael.

2.?????Future-forward your events by switching to multi-site hybrid and online

Traditional events held in one location are, for operational reasons, exclusive rather than inclusive. There is too high a cost – in both dollar figures and time away from main work – for all your people to attend. Not to mention the carbon impact from flying and transporting all your people into one location. The solution? Multi-site hybrid and online events – and I promise you, they work when they’re done right.

Online events

So, what did Michael have to say about online? “Online has the potential to reduce the carbon footprint of events by 95%, and by its nature, online is far more inclusive. However, we’re all familiar with Zoom Fatigue – and organisations must guard against this”.
